This trial will evaluate the efficacy, safety, and pharmacokinetics of sugammadex for the reversal of both moderate and deep neuromuscular blockade (NMB) induced by either rocuronium or vecuronium in pediatric participants. The primary efficacy hypothesis of this investigation is that sugammadex is superior to neostigmine in reversing moderate NMB in pediatric participants as measured by time to recovery to a train-of-four (TOF) ratio of ≥0.9.
详细描述
This trial will be conducted in two parts: Part A and Part B. In Part A, pharmacokinetic (PK) sampling will be conducted to identify the pediatric dose providing sugammadex exposure similar to adults. For Part B participants, the efficacy of sugammadex (i.e. time to recovery of the TOF ratio) will be assessed. Further, safety analyses will be conducted in both Parts A and B. Following completion of Part A, an interim analysis (IA) of the PK and safety data will be performed. Once the appropriate doses are confirmed and safety data is assessed for the 2 doses of sugammadex, then Part B will commence.

入选标准
- •Be categorized as American Society of Anesthesiologists (ASA) Physical Status Class 1, 2, or
- •Have a planned non-emergent surgical procedure or clinical situation (e.g., intubation) that requires moderate or deep NMB with either rocuronium or vecuronium.
- •Have a planned surgical procedure or clinical situation that would allow objective neuromuscular monitoring techniques to be applied with access to the arm for neuromuscular transmission monitoring.
- •Age between 2 to <17 years at Visit
- •If female, may participate if she is not pregnant, not breastfeeding, and at least one of the following: 1) Not a woman of childbearing potential (WOCBP); or 2) A WOCBP who agrees to follow the study contraceptive guidance during the treatment period and for at least 7 days after the last dose of study treatment.
排除标准
- •Has any clinically significant condition or situation (eg, anatomical malformation that complicates intubation) other than the condition being studied that, in the opinion of the investigator, would interfere with the trial evaluations or optimal participation in the trial.
- •Has a neuromuscular disorder that may affect NMB and/or trial assessments.
- •Is dialysis-dependent or has (or is suspected of having) severe renal insufficiency (defined as estimated glomerular filtration rate (eGFR) <30 ml/min).
- •Has or is suspected of having a family or personal history of malignant hyperthermia.
- •Has or is suspected of having an allergy to study treatments or its/their excipients, to opioids/opiates, muscle relaxants or their excipients, or other medication(s) used during general anesthesia.
- •Has received or is planned to receive toremifene and/or fusidic acid via IV administration within 24 hours before or within 24 hours after administration of study treatment.
- •Has been previously treated with sugammadex or has participated in a sugammadex clinical trial.
- •Is currently participating in or has participated in an interventional clinical trial with an investigational compound or device within 30 days of signing the informed consent/assent for this current trial.

Neostigmine (Part B)
Single i.v. bolus containing neostigmine (50 μg/kg; up to 5 mg maximum dose) in combination with either glycopyrrolate (10 μg/kg) or atropine sulfate (20 μg/kg).

Time to Recovery of Participant Train-of-Four (TOF) Ratio to ≥0.9 [Part B]
时间窗: Up to 30 minutes post-dose
The time to recovery of TOF ratio to ≥0.9 after administration of study intervention was determined for each Part B arm. The TOF ratio is the ratio of the magnitude of the fourth (T4) and first (T1) thumb twitches elicited by 4 electrical stimulations of the ulnar nerve, indicating the current degree of NMB as a decimal from 0 (loss of T4 twitch) to 1 (no NMB). Values closer to 1 indicate less NMB. Per protocol, the efficacy analysis is based on comparison of the Part B: Sugammadex 2 mg arm versus the Part B: Neostigmine + (Glycopyrrolate or Atropine) arm.
